As Saltaire said, senority isn't the most important thing . . . it's everything.

This is why you have some relatively senior pilots bidding FO positions rather than Captain. Why? Since their job security is not the issue, other things such as having more influence in their schedule, where they want to live, what kind of flying they want to do, or they really like the type of airplane. I've know a few fellows for whom money is not the major issue-- one's wife was a highly sought after attorney, he just went to fly to get out of the mansion.
